Why is pressure gauge inspection so important?
Fire extinguishers are typically filled with nitrogen or other inert gases as a propellant. These gases provide the necessary pressure to discharge the extinguishing agent. The pressure gauge displays the real-time pressure inside the extinguisher. If the pressure is too low, the extinguishing agent will not be discharged effectively or will not be discharged far enough; if the pressure is too high, there is a risk of explosion. The green area on the fire extinguisher's pressure gauge generally indicates that the extinguisher is within the safe and effective pressure range. Any deviation from the green area indicates a possible problem with the extinguisher and requires immediate maintenance or replacement.
Daily Inspection Frequency: Weekly is the gold standard.
From a professional perspective, fire extinguisher pressure gauges should be inspected weekly. This frequency allows for timely detection of potential problems without placing excessive burden on management personnel. Weekly inspections should be conducted by designated personnel, and detailed records should be kept. Inspections should primarily include:
Observe the pressure gauge needle: The needle must remain stable within the green zone. If the needle deviates into the red zone (indicating low or high pressure), the fire extinguisher must be inspected or replaced immediately.
Inspect the pressure gauge: Check for damage, cracks, or blurring. Any visual damage may affect the accuracy of the reading.
Inspect the fire extinguisher seal: Verify that the seal or seal on the fire extinguisher is intact. A damaged seal may indicate that the fire extinguisher has been used or tampered with.
In addition to routine weekly inspections, the following situations also require immediate additional inspections:
After the fire extinguisher has been moved or subjected to vibration
After a drastic change in ambient temperature
After annual maintenance or overhaul
Requirements of Fire Protection Regulations and Industry Standards
According to relevant national fire protection regulations and industry standards, such as the "Code for Acceptance and Inspection of Fire Extinguishers in Buildings" (GB 50444), fire extinguisher maintenance must adhere to strict regulations. These regulations clearly state that fire extinguishers should be regularly inspected by professionals, and detailed inspection records should be maintained. For businesses and institutions, incorporating fire extinguisher management into routine safety inspections is a crucial step in ensuring compliance and safety.

The Importance of Inspection Records
Inspection records are an essential part of a professional fire extinguisher management system. A complete inspection record should include:
Inspection date and time
Fire extinguisher number and type
Pressure gauge reading
Inspector's signature
Important findings and corrective actions
These records not only facilitate traceability and management but also serve as strong evidence of compliance during fire department inspections. By establishing standardized management processes, enterprises can effectively avoid potential fire risks and ensure the safety of production and operations.
